Handover note — Crumbwheel order cutoffs.

Welcome aboard. The bakery cutoff rule in Crumbwheel closes same-day orders at 14:00 local to each storefront, not UTC — this has bitten us twice. Holiday overrides live in the calendar service and take precedence silently, so always check there first when a cutoff looks wrong. To unlock the calendar service's admin console after a restart, enter the recovery passphrase below.

vault phrase of bagap-bahaf = silion-pelox-sorox-casdor-quenwyn-fraax-eliox-praael-kelion-quenvan-kasox-rusael-norius-belvan

The Chronoline API reports and corrects clock skew across Hallerton build agents. Agents poll /v1/skew every 30s; deltas over 250ms mark the agent unschedulable until resynced. Do not disable skew checks — signed artifact timestamps depend on them. All endpoints require the internal service key in the X-Chronoline-Key header. Rate limit is 600 requests per minute per agent. For contractor sandbox access, use the key provided below.

API key for fahip-kahip: zpat23_XiJGUHz5xfaAtaIqUkus0rh

## Deploying the Gatewick Proctor Queue

Deploys are pretty painless: push to main, wait for the pipeline, then watch the queue drain dashboard for five minutes. If candidates pile up mid-exam, roll back first and ask questions later — the queue replays safely. Everything the workers care about lives in one config block, shown here for reference.

settings of bafof-yagef:
JOROX_PIN=8740
JOROX_TENANT=pelox
JOROX_METRICS_HOST=metrics.jorox.qorvelworks.internal
JOROX_SEAL=seal_c78f63c1
JOROX_STANDBY_TEAM=norax

**Runbook fragment: Firmware update channel rollback (Halcyonix devices)**

When a staged rollout on the Halcyonix firmware channel shows elevated failure telemetry (above 2% within the first hour), pause the channel before investigating — do not unpublish, as that strands devices mid-download. Confirm the failure cluster is not regional connectivity noise by cross-checking the fleet dashboard. If genuine, demote the release to the canary ring and notify the on-call lead. For this week's sync, the implicated build token appears below.

pipeline stamp: htk31_f769b577b3028a4e9958e5bb8d1259a